Food for Thought Café

When you need to take a little time out before work or grab something to go, Food for Thought Café should be your first port of call. Open Wednesday to Sunday from 7:00am, this café offers stunning ocean views and friendly service, making it a local favourite. Whether you’re after a quick coffee or you need to sit down, rest up and have some lunch, Food for Thought Café offers it all. Using fresh, local produce, you can rest easy knowing all their delicious meals are made fresh onsite every day—right down to their moreish hollandaise sauce. Filling and full of flavour, you are sure to love every bite!
Where: 6/1 Normanby Street, Yeppoon QLD 4703

The Coffee Club

Nothing soothes the soul quite like a delicious coffee coupled with stunning ocean views. Offering full table service, all you have to do at The Coffee Club is choose a seat by the window and take in the tranquil ocean view. This is a great place to unwind after a long day at work or the perfect place to pick up your morning coffee. Looking for something light to take with you to work? Choose one of The Coffee Club’s delectable cakes or savoury treats—ideal for brekky on the run. With a vast range of menu items available, and all at very affordable prices, it’s no wonder The Coffee Club in Yeppoon is so popular!
Where: 18-22 Anzac Parade, Yeppoon QLD 4703

Keppel Bay Sailing Club

Come to the Keppel Bay Sailing Club for great views and a hot meal. Just a stone’s throw from the main clubhouse, the club’s restaurant, Spinnaker, provides food with a view. With lunch and dinner options available, topped off by their unbeatable location right by the beach, this club is the perfect place to unwind after a big day at work or to host that small business lunch. Indulge in some creamy garlic prawns, or try some of their amazing grilled vegetable lasagne. For dinner with a view, Spinnaker at the Keppel Bay Sailing Club really can’t be beaten. Even better—members get a 10 per cent discount on all meals! So head down to Keppel Bay Sailing Club’s Spinnaker restaurant for great local atmosphere, fantastic food and rolling ocean scenery. It doesn’t get much more relaxing than this!
Where: Anzac Parade, Yeppoon QLD 4703
